Integrating Disaster Simulation Models for Emergency Response

In current emergency response or decision support systems, many simulation models are used individually to study emergency or disaster scenarios. The effects of these models may be significantly enhanced if they can be integrated to study the sequence of an emergency response scenario with a right context. This paper presents an architecture for integration of disaster simulation models for analyzing emergency response scenarios. In the Model Integration Architecture (MIA), all the simulation models are running upon Geographic Information System (GIS) and databases.The inputs and outputs of the integrated models are redirected to connect with each other. Disaster evolution prediction, impact areas demarcation, human behavior simulation and real-time data acquisition were integrated and considered in a correlative manner.
